It wasn't so much about HH the Karmapa as it was about the author's own process of coming to donate a part of his body to a friend, and the consequences for himself - unexpected - of having done so. A window into the inside of this decision process and the reactions of others as well as his own reactions.
I would like to hear this one - a 4 I would say. It describes well the intersection between secular and religious thinking, and the generosity driving the decision provides a very personal counterpoint to much of the current public discourse.
Well produced and paced also.
